This position requires holiday hours. Qualifications In order to qualify for a Nurse (Research Specialist), GS-0610-12 position, you must: A. Have a graduate or higher-level degree, bachelor's degree, or associate degree from an accredited professional nursing educational program. NOTE: Degree from a Foreign Nursing School: Official certification from the Commission on Graduates of Foreign Nursing Schools is required for individuals who graduated from foreign nursing schools. AND B. Have passed the National Council Licensure Examination for Registered Nurses (NCLEX-RN). AND C. Possess a current, active, full and unrestricted license, or registration as a professional nurse from a State, the District of Columbia, the Commonwealth of Puerto Rico, or a territory of the United States in the clinical specialty required by the position. AND In addition to meeting the educational requirement, in order to qualify for a Nurse (Research Specialist) position at the GS-0610-12 level, you must have at least 1 year of Clinical Nurse experience equivalent to at least the GS-0610-11 level in the federal service obtained in either the private or public sector, performing the following types of tasks: experience performing cytapheresis is a necessity of the position; providing clinical care to varying patient populations with complex needs; serving as nurse or coordinator for a specific population of patients; initiating appropriate referrals and coordinating routine care; assessing complex and sensitive health education needs in individual patient populations with like conditions, protocols or other characteristics.
